Team News, Form and Predicted Line-Up as Oxford United Welcome QPR

Oxford United will be looking to build on their point against Bristol City when QPR visit Grenoble Road on Tuesday night.

The U’s played out a goalless draw against the promotion-chasing Robins and kept just their third clean sheet of the season in the process.

As for the R’s, they have two wins, two draws and two defeats from their last six league games, ending that run with a goalless draw at Stoke at the weekend. They are also without a win in any of their last five away games. Despite that, they have a respectable record on the road with four wins and four draws from 14.

Rumarn Burrell is the top scorer for the visitors with ten Championship goals, but he will miss the game with injury. Will Lankshear leads the way for the U’s with seven in all competitions.

The U’s are without a handful of players, including Tyler Goodrham, Przemyslaw Placheta and loanee, Jamie Donley. However, new signing Jamie McDonnell is in contention to make his debut after signing from Nottingham Forest.

In addition to Burrell, the R’s are without Ilias Chair, Ziyad Larkeche, Kwame Poku, Koki Saito, Harvey Vale, Jake Clarke-Salter and Liam Morrison. Jonathan Varane is also a doubt with a knock.

Oxford are without a win in the last five meetings against QPR, losing four, but did draw the most recent encounter at Loftus Road. Four of those fixtures came in West London, with QPR victorious in their last visit to Grenoble Road in what was Des Buckingham’s final home game in charge of the U’s.
